Measuring Environmental Resilience Using Q-Methods: A Malaysian Perspective

Communities increasingly need tools that can help them assess the environmental risks they face to understand better their capacities in mitigation, preparedness, response, and recovery. Environmental resilience (ER) is a crucial feature of community not adequately covered literature. This paper proposes an inclusive, participatory approach achieve stakeholder engagement on definitions, objectives, indicators for measuring ER at level. study uses 5-step utilising Q-methods contextualise index Resilience (ER). An initial set 57 from 13 frameworks literature was reduced 25 by combining similar type, format terminology. A total 10 participants two groups (academics practitioners) took part interviews Q-sort workshops Malaysia this study. Both identified Ecosystem monitoring as one most critical ER, closely followed rapid damage assessments effective communication system. The exercise also revealed marked differences between regarding importance fair access basic needs services citizens, priority academics, value building green infrastructure, practitioners, with significant difference natural defences community. Capacity Assessment Tool (ER-CAT), proposed paper, be used local governments communities engagement, discussion consensus select are relevant contexts.
